    This thesis aimed to uncover the visual representational practices used by the media to represent the Palestinian refugees to their audience. Mainly focusing on their representation under the event of the defunding of the UNRWA by the US in three different international newspapers, and by drawing upon different qualitative frameworks for analysis mainly Critical Discourse Analysis and Critical Visual Analysis, this thesis has concluded that there are three recurring themes under which Palestinian refugees are represented: as a female, as a crowd and as a person in need of aid. By delving into the origins of these themes of representation it was found that they reflect the need for specific humanitarian interventions. Many of these interventions aim to accelerate achieving certain development goals, such as the MDGs or their successors the SDGs among others. Since Palestinian refugees are prime targets of humanitarian intervention and international aid since their displacement in 1948, they are viewed as the ideal target group to achieve these goals. Hence, Palestinian refugees are visually portrayed as in need of the standardized and generic humanitarian interventions which target them.This thesis aimed to uncover the visual representational practices used by the media to represent the Palestinian refugees to their audience.
